ABSTRACT
The CRISPR genome editing technology shows great application prospects in gene manipulation and infectious disease research, and is of great value for effective control and cure of infectious diseases. It has been utilized to generate specific disease models in cells, organoids and animals, which provide great convenience for research into the molecular mechanisms associated with infectious diseases. CRISPR screening technology enables high-throughput identification of risk factors. New molecular diagnostic tools based on CRISPR offer a more sensitive and faster method for detecting pathogens. The use of CRISPR tools to introduce resistance genes or to specifically destroy risk genes and virus genomes is intended to help prevent or treat infectious diseases. This review discusses the application of CRISPR genome editing technologies in the construction of disease models, screening of risk factors, pathogen diagnosis, and prevention and treatment of infectious diseases, thereby providing a reference for follow-up research in pathogenesis, diagnosis, prevention and treatment of infectious diseases.
